Sans Superellipse Undo 8 is a very bold, very wide, monoline, upright, tall x-height font.

A heavy, geometric sans built from rounded-rectangle forms with softened corners and largely uniform stroke weight. Counters tend toward rectangular and superelliptical shapes, creating a tight, engineered rhythm with minimal contrast. Many joins and terminals are squared-off or clipped, and diagonals are used sparingly and decisively, giving letters a constructed, modular feel. Lowercase follows the same boxy logic with a tall x-height and short extenders, while numerals adopt the same rounded-square geometry for consistent texture in mixed settings.
Best suited to punchy headlines, poster typography, and identity work where a strong, engineered silhouette is an asset. It also fits gaming and esports graphics, sports branding, packaging callouts, and UI/tech interface titling where a compact, modular texture supports a futuristic tone.
The overall tone is assertive and mechanical, leaning into a techno and industrial aesthetic. Its chunky, rounded-square structure reads as modern and equipment-like, suggesting speed, hardware, and UI surfaces rather than editorial warmth.
The design appears intended to deliver maximum impact with a streamlined, rounded-square geometry that stays consistent across the character set. It prioritizes bold presence and a cohesive, system-like feel for modern branding and display typography.
The large interior openings and clear separation between strokes keep the forms punchy at display sizes, while the tight, squared counters can feel dense in longer passages. The design maintains strong stylistic consistency across caps, lowercase, and figures, producing a uniform, logo-ready silhouette.
